Runbook: Scanline barcode bridge

If warehouse scans stop flowing into Cartwheel, it's almost always the bridge service on the Dunmore floor box wedging after a USB hiccup. Bounce the service first — nine times out of ten that fixes it. If not, check the queue depth before escalating. When restarting, make sure the bridge comes up with these settings.

deployment values, yafop-bajef:
[gilok]
team = ulaius
access_code = ac_423664
host = gilok.sivrelhq.corp
port = 9200
owner = pelius.istax
peer = eliok.torvasoft.internal

### Reminder job: quick ops notes

The Lanternwell clinic reminder job kicks off nightly and batches SMS-style notices through the Murrow dispatcher. If it stalls, it's almost always a stuck lease — just clear it and rerun; the job is idempotent, so duplicates won't go out. Heads up for review: the retry window was recently shortened. The job currently runs with the values listed below.

service settings:
PRAIX_LOG_LEVEL=error
PRAIX_METRICS_HOST=metrics.praix.qorvelcorp.corp
PRAIX_POOL_SIZE=16

## Data Stores: Soft Deletes in `orders`

Heads up: rows in the Pellwick `orders` table are never hard-deleted. A cancellation just sets `deleted_at`, so always filter on `deleted_at IS NULL` or your counts will look inflated. The nightly sweeper archives anything soft-deleted for over 90 days. If a customer claims an order vanished, it's almost always sitting there flagged. To poke around yourself, connect with the string below.

primary connection of kahof-kagep = mssql://belath_svc:3uqY4g6LHG5Nyi@db-d0ba.ferralabs.corp:5432/rusdor

Subject: DR drill Thursday — websocket notes for the newbies

Hi all! Thursday's disaster-recovery drill will fail over the Pipewren gateway to the Castlemere region, and you'll notice websocket latency shift. Quick context: we run permessage-deflate on chat streams but not telemetry — compression saves bandwidth there but burns CPU we can't spare during failover. During the drill, keep compression settings untouched. To access the failover console you'll need the drill recovery passphrase, which for this exercise is:

recovery phrase for fafof-kagaf: eliath-zormir